Kwara PDP To KWSIEC: Obey Court Order On LG Poll
According to a news report from New Telegraph, the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) in Kwara State has issued a stern caution to the state Independent Electoral Commission (KWSIEC). It implored the electoral body to conform to a recent judicial directive that has expressly barred the local government election scheduled for September 21.
The party has affirmed its preparedness to participate in the polls, provided KWASIEC abides to the rules and regulations;
“Kicked against illegal actions deliberately concocted as a booby trap to ensure the nullification of the outcome of the elections if it does not favour the government in power.”
A federal high court in Abuja had restrained the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) from releasing the national voter register to the KWSIEC to conduct the September 21 local government election in the state, pending the hearing and determination of the motion on notice filed by PDP for interlocutory injunction.
Justice Peter Lifu also stopped KWSIEC and the state Attorney General (AG) from receiving, accepting, or using the national voter register or any part relating to Kwara State from the electoral body for the council's election in Kwara State.
